cocos2dx-js socket.io

Hi guys i am implementing a simple chat in my app using socket io…
i was able to connect to my server and emit an event. but when i build it in a native platform(exe/android)
i can still connect to the server but when i emit an event my server does not response any idea?

i thought that it is already fixed in 1.x version of socket.io

socket.io version is v1.3.7
and here is my code

in my cocos2d app

var TestScene= cc.Scene.extend({
    onEnter:function () {
        this._super();
        // connect to my node.js server
        var io = Socket.connect("localhost:3000");
         // this will send a chat message event to my server
        io.emit('chat message','a message from cocos2d!');
    }
});

in my server side (app.js)

var app = require('express')();
var http = require('http').Server(app);
var io = require('socket.io')(http);

app.get('/', function(req, res){
      res.sendFile(__dirname + '/index.html');
});

io.on('connection', function(socket){
    console.log("a socket connection stablished");
      socket.on('chat message', function(msg){
         console.log("chat message :"+msg);// not working on native build but working in web version
      });
});

http.listen(3000, function(){
      console.log('listening on *:3000');
});

it does not console.log my message from native build of my cocos app

/** @expose */
window.io;

var SocketIO = SocketIO || window.io;

var SocketIOTestLayer = cc.Layer.extend({

    _sioClient: null,
    _sioEndpoint: null,
    _sioClientStatus: null,

    ctor:function () {
        this._super();
        this.init();
    },

    init: function () {

        var winSize = cc.director.getWinSize();
        
        var MARGIN = 40;
        var SPACE = 35;
        
        var label = new cc.LabelTTF("SocketIO Test", "Arial", 28);
        label.setPosition(cc.p(winSize.width / 2, winSize.height - MARGIN));
        this.addChild(label, 0);
        
        var menuRequest = new cc.Menu();
        menuRequest.setPosition(cc.p(0, 0));
        this.addChild(menuRequest);

        // Test to create basic client in the default namespace
        var labelSIOClient = new cc.LabelTTF("Open SocketIO Client", "Arial", 22);
        labelSIOClient.setAnchorPoint(cc.p(0,0));
        var itemSIOClient = new cc.MenuItemLabel(labelSIOClient, this.onMenuSIOClientClicked, this);
        itemSIOClient.setPosition(cc.p(labelSIOClient.getContentSize().width / 2 + MARGIN, winSize.height - MARGIN - SPACE));
        menuRequest.addChild(itemSIOClient);

        // Test to create a client at the endpoint '/testpoint'
        var labelSIOEndpoint = new cc.LabelTTF("Open SocketIO Endpoint", "Arial", 22);
        labelSIOEndpoint.setAnchorPoint(cc.p(0,0));
        var itemSIOEndpoint = new cc.MenuItemLabel(labelSIOEndpoint, this.onMenuSIOEndpointClicked, this);
        itemSIOEndpoint.setPosition(cc.p(winSize.width - (labelSIOEndpoint.getContentSize().width / 2 + MARGIN), winSize.height - MARGIN - SPACE));
        menuRequest.addChild(itemSIOEndpoint);

        // Test sending message to default namespace
        var labelTestMessage = new cc.LabelTTF("Send Test Message", "Arial", 22);
        labelTestMessage.setAnchorPoint(cc.p(0,0));
        var itemTestMessage = new cc.MenuItemLabel(labelTestMessage, this.onMenuTestMessageClicked, this);
        itemTestMessage.setPosition(cc.p(labelTestMessage.getContentSize().width / 2 + MARGIN, winSize.height - MARGIN - 2 * SPACE));
        menuRequest.addChild(itemTestMessage);

        // Test sending message to the endpoint '/testpoint'
        var labelTestMessageEndpoint = new cc.LabelTTF("Test Endpoint Message", "Arial", 22);
        labelTestMessageEndpoint.setAnchorPoint(cc.p(0,0));
        var itemTestMessageEndpoint = new cc.MenuItemLabel(labelTestMessageEndpoint, this.onMenuTestMessageEndpointClicked, this);
        itemTestMessageEndpoint.setPosition(cc.p(winSize.width - (labelTestMessageEndpoint.getContentSize().width / 2 + MARGIN), winSize.height - MARGIN - 2 * SPACE));
        menuRequest.addChild(itemTestMessageEndpoint);

        // Test sending event 'echotest' to default namespace
        var labelTestEvent = new cc.LabelTTF("Send Test Event", "Arial", 22);
        labelTestEvent.setAnchorPoint(cc.p(0,0));
        var itemTestEvent = new cc.MenuItemLabel(labelTestEvent, this.onMenuTestEventClicked, this);
        itemTestEvent.setPosition(cc.p(labelTestEvent.getContentSize().width / 2 + MARGIN, winSize.height - MARGIN - 3 * SPACE));
        menuRequest.addChild(itemTestEvent);

        // Test sending event 'echotest' to the endpoint '/testpoint'
        var labelTestEventEndpoint = new cc.LabelTTF("Test Endpoint Event", "Arial", 22);
        labelTestEventEndpoint.setAnchorPoint(cc.p(0,0));
        var itemTestEventEndpoint = new cc.MenuItemLabel(labelTestEventEndpoint, this.onMenuTestEventEndpointClicked, this);
        itemTestEventEndpoint.setPosition(cc.p(winSize.width - (labelTestEventEndpoint.getContentSize().width / 2 + MARGIN), winSize.height - MARGIN - 3 * SPACE));
        menuRequest.addChild(itemTestEventEndpoint);

        // Test disconnecting basic client
        var labelTestClientDisconnect = new cc.LabelTTF("Disconnect Socket", "Arial", 22);
        labelTestClientDisconnect.setAnchorPoint(cc.p(0,0));
        var itemClientDisconnect = new cc.MenuItemLabel(labelTestClientDisconnect, this.onMenuTestClientDisconnectClicked, this);
        itemClientDisconnect.setPosition(cc.p(labelTestClientDisconnect.getContentSize().width / 2 + MARGIN, winSize.height - MARGIN - 4 * SPACE));
        menuRequest.addChild(itemClientDisconnect);

        // Test disconnecting the endpoint '/testpoint'
        var labelTestEndpointDisconnect = new cc.LabelTTF("Disconnect Endpoint", "Arial", 22);
        labelTestEndpointDisconnect.setAnchorPoint(cc.p(0,0));
        var itemTestEndpointDisconnect = new cc.MenuItemLabel(labelTestEndpointDisconnect, this.onMenuTestEndpointDisconnectClicked, this);
        itemTestEndpointDisconnect.setPosition(cc.p(winSize.width - (labelTestEndpointDisconnect.getContentSize().width / 2 + MARGIN), winSize.height - MARGIN - 4 * SPACE));
        menuRequest.addChild(itemTestEndpointDisconnect);

        this._sioClientStatus = new cc.LabelTTF("Not connected...", "Arial", 14);
        this._sioClientStatus.setAnchorPoint(cc.p(0, 0));
        this._sioClientStatus.setPosition(cc.p(0,winSize.height * .25));
        this.addChild(this._sioClientStatus);

        // Back Menu
        var itemBack = new cc.MenuItemFont("Back", this.toExtensionsMainLayer, this);
        itemBack.setPosition(cc.p(winSize.width - 50, 25));
        var menuBack = new cc.Menu(itemBack);
        menuBack.setPosition(cc.p(0, 0));
        this.addChild(menuBack);

        return true;
    },

    onExit: function() {
        if(this._sioEndpoint) this._sioEndpoint.disconnect();
        if(this._sioClient) this._sioClient.disconnect();

        this._super();
    },

    //socket callback for testing
    testevent: function(data) {
        var msg = this.tag + " says 'testevent' with data: " + data;
        this.statusLabel.setString(msg);
        cc.log(msg);
    },

    message: function(data) {
        var msg = this.tag + " received message: " + data;
        this.statusLabel.setString(msg);
        cc.log(msg);
    },

    disconnection: function() {
        var msg = this.tag + " disconnected!";
        this.statusLabel.setString(msg);
        cc.log(msg);
    },
    // Menu Callbacks
    onMenuSIOClientClicked: function(sender) {

        //create a client by using this static method, url does not need to contain the protocol
        var sioclient = SocketIO.connect("ws://tools.itharbors.com:4000", {"force new connection" : true});

        //if you need to track multiple sockets it is best to store them with tags in your own array for now
        sioclient.tag = "Test Client";

        //attaching the status label to the socketio client
        //this is only necessary in javascript due to scope within shared event handlers,
        //as 'this' will refer to the socketio client
        sioclient.statusLabel = this._sioClientStatus;

        //register event callbacks
        //this is an example of a handler declared inline
        sioclient.on("connect", function() {
            var msg = sioclient.tag + " Connected!";
            this.statusLabel.setString(msg);
            cc.log(msg);
            sioclient.send(msg);
        });

        //example of a handler that is shared between multiple clients
        sioclient.on("message", this.message);

        sioclient.on("echotest", function(data) {
            cc.log("echotest 'on' callback fired!");
            var msg = this.tag + " says 'echotest' with data: " + data;
            this.statusLabel.setString(msg);
            cc.log(msg);
        });

        sioclient.on("testevent", this.testevent);

        sioclient.on("disconnect", this.disconnection);

        this._sioClient = sioclient;

    },

    onMenuSIOEndpointClicked: function(sender) {

        //repeat the same connection steps for the namespace "testpoint"
        var sioendpoint = SocketIO.connect("ws://tools.itharbors.com:4000/testpoint", {"force new connection" : true});

        //a tag to differentiate in shared callbacks
        sioendpoint.tag = "Test Endpoint";

        sioendpoint.statusLabel = this._sioClientStatus;

        sioendpoint.on("connect", function() {
            var msg = sioendpoint.tag + " Connected!";
            this.statusLabel.setString(msg);
            cc.log(msg);
            sioendpoint.send(msg);
        });

        //register event callbacks
        sioendpoint.on("echotest", function(data) {
            cc.log("echotest 'on' callback fired!");
            var msg = this.tag + " says 'echotest' with data: " + data;
            this.statusLabel.setString(msg);
            cc.log(msg);
        });

        sioendpoint.on("message", this.message);

        //demonstrating how callbacks can be shared within a delegate
        sioendpoint.on("testevent", this.testevent);

        sioendpoint.on("disconnect", this.disconnection);

        this._sioEndpoint = sioendpoint;

    },

    onMenuTestMessageClicked: function(sender) {

        //check that the socket is != NULL before sending or emitting events
        //the client should be NULL either before initialization and connection or after disconnect
        if(this._sioClient != null) this._sioClient.send("Hello Socket.IO!");

    },

    onMenuTestMessageEndpointClicked: function(sender) {

        if(this._sioEndpoint != null) this._sioEndpoint.send("Hello Socket.IO!");

    },

    onMenuTestEventClicked: function(sender) {

        if(this._sioClient != null) this._sioClient.emit("echotest","[{\"name\":\"myname\",\"type\":\"mytype\"}]");

    },

    onMenuTestEventEndpointClicked: function(sender) {

        if(this._sioEndpoint != null) this._sioEndpoint.emit("echotest","[{\"name\":\"myname\",\"type\":\"mytype\"}]");

    },

    onMenuTestClientDisconnectClicked: function(sender) {

        if(this._sioClient != null) this._sioClient.disconnect();

    },

    onMenuTestEndpointDisconnectClicked: function(sender) {

        if(this._sioEndpoint != null) this._sioEndpoint.disconnect();

    },

    toExtensionsMainLayer: function (sender) {
        var scene = new ExtensionsTestScene();
        scene.runThisTest();
    }
});

var runSocketIOTest = function () {
    var pScene = new cc.Scene();
    var pLayer = new SocketIOTestLayer();
    pScene.addChild(pLayer);
    cc.director.runScene(pScene);
};

and you should add “socketio” in your project.json first

All you have to do is go to : SocketIO.cpp file and
change
_separator = “:”;

to
_separator = “”;
